Cool or white roofing in response to climate change many are looking to cool roofing as an option which is a reflective coating that permits the roof to reflect the warmth of the sun instead of retaining it.
Thermoset membranes are made with layers of synthetic rubber polymers such as epdm cspe and neoprene.

Single ply roofing is a popular option for commercial buildings and can be used on any slope of roof.
Rolled roofing can be applied either with the torch down method or with roofing nails.

Economical to produce relatively easy to install and widely available fiberglass asphalt shingles are today s most popular roofing material.
